Management Meeting Minutes — Reseller Programme

Present: Dena Forsgate, Ollie Rennick, Priya Calloway.

Quick recap: the Fernlight reseller programme is tracking ahead of plan — 14 partners signed versus the 10 we'd hoped for. Margins are a bit thinner than modelled, mostly down to the tiered discount we offered early joiners. Ollie will tighten the discount bands before the next intake. Where we want to take the programme next is covered in the note below.

board note of yahip-tadug: Headcount on the Zorath team goes from 9 to 100 by the end of April. Gross margin on Zorath came in at 10 percent against a plan of 20 percent.

Minutes — Management Meeting

Prepared for the incoming director. Topic: possible acquisition of Greyfen Analytics. Due diligence 70% complete. Valuation gap remains; Greyfen seeks a premium. Integration risks flagged by Ops. Decision deferred to next month. Talla Nyberg leads negotiations. Our walk-away position is stated below.

board note of fawig-kagup: Only 48 of the 435 pilot accounts renewed Rusion, so a churn review is set for September 12. Fenwynox Logistics is in early talks to buy Sorielek Systems for about $117.8 million.

### The Canteen (and our neighbours)

Heads up: our canteen on Level 2 is shared with Ostermead Analytics next door — their folk come through the linking corridor around midday, so don't be surprised by unfamiliar faces at lunch. They're entitled to be there, no visitor passes needed, but they shouldn't wander past the canteen into our office side. If anyone from Ostermead asks reception for access beyond the corridor, send them back politely. The corridor door itself is keypad-controlled and uses the code below.

staff pass of tagef-kawif = bdg-CD-0